1. "The love of gardening is a seed once sown that never dies." - Gertrude Jekyll
Gertrude Jekyll was an influential British horticulturist and garden designer who lived in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. Her quote reminds us that once we fall in love with gardening, it becomes a lifelong passion that we can enjoy for years to come.

3. "Gardening is a way of showing that you believe in tomorrow." - Audrey Hepburn
Audrey Hepburn was a beloved actress and humanitarian who also loved to garden. Her quote is a reminder that when we plant seeds and tend to our gardens, we are investing in a brighter future.
